each element has it's ups and downs.

For water, your source is everywhere, water element jutsus are easiest to use when around a source of water, for example a lake, also it's easier after rain. Water jutsus aim to drown a person to death.

Wind jutsus have a continual source, and is used more widely in close range due to the sharpness of each attack, wind attacks are piercers, meaning they'll pierce through any attack, defense or a set of people even. Wind jutsus aim to slice and dice.

Thunder, it's fast, it's powerful, but only when concentrated into one pin point strike like Chidori or Raikiri. Thunder is much like electricity, it can flow throughout just about anything, it aims to stun an opponent or electrocute them. Thunder jutsus aim to stun the opponent to allow the user to input a killing blow.

Earth jutsus are defensive, they're not meant for killing at all, and serve as a perfect defensive. While it's weak against lightning, it's resistant to every other element, especially fire. Earth jutsus aim to defend the user whenever the time comes.

Fire jutsus are a strong offensive jutsu, while it may not serve as a great killing blow type of technique, it is certainly large, meaning it's better suited to fighting more than one opponent. While fighting with one opponent is not what it's suited for, it'll have better chances at hitting them. Fire jutsus aim to engulf their opponent in the flames.
